We have Acronis managed on a Windows 2012 R2 server (primary DC) and storing to a networked Synlogy device.

Our desktops are running a full backup weekly with daily differentials.

The desktop in question has two full backups with differentials between. When loading up the recovery options the first (oldest) backup does not show up in the list. Though when browsing in windows file explorer to the network location the file is there.

Opening (double-clicking) on the TIB files in Windows file explorer works (able to browse backup discs/foders) for all files but the one in question. Attached is the error

Is there a way to recover this file?

Thank you for your posting! Copy or export the backup in question to the different (better local drive) location and validate it. Does the validation reveal any problems? If validation is sucessfull, create a recovery task (in the backup source specify the path to the backup and click on Refresh) - is the backup recognised?
